driver/uart: Introduce a way for mainboard to override the baudrate
The rationale is to allow the mainboard to override the default baudrate for instance by sampling GPIOs at boot. A new configuration option is available for mainboards to select this behaviour. It will then have to define the function get_uart_baudrate to return the computed baudrate.
